Kia Rio: Inspection| Rear Brake Disc Thickness Check |
| 1. |
Check the brake pads for wear and fade.
|
| 2. |
Check the brake disc for damage and cracks.
|
| 3. |
Remove all rust and contamination from the surface, and measure
the disc thickness at 12 points, at least, of same distance (5mm) from
the brake disc outer circle.
|
| 4. |
If wear exceeds the limit, replace the discs and pad assembly
left and right of the vehicle.
|
| Rear Brake Pad Check |
| 1. |
Check the pad wear. Measure the pad thickness and replace it,
if it is less than the specified value.
|
| 2. |
Check that grease is applied, to sliding contact points. Check
for metal damage to the pad and backing.
